Career path
| Career Role (Conservation Law) | Description |
|---|---|
| Environmental Lawyer | Advising on environmental legislation, representing clients in environmental disputes, and ensuring compliance. High demand for expertise in UK environmental law. |
| Conservation Officer | Enforcing environmental regulations, investigating breaches, and promoting sustainable practices. Key role in protecting natural resources and habitats across the UK. |
| Sustainability Consultant | Guiding organizations towards environmentally responsible practices. Growing demand for professionals who can navigate complex environmental regulations and promote sustainable business strategies in the UK. |
| Planning Officer (Conservation Focus) | Assessing planning applications for their environmental impact and ensuring compliance with conservation regulations. Significant role in balancing development with environmental protection in the UK. |
| Policy Analyst (Environmental Policy) | Researching and analyzing environmental policies, providing recommendations to policymakers. Influential role in shaping environmental law and policy in the UK. |
